I have a macro that locatesa specified window and kills it off and then opens another application. Unfortuantely if the window doesn't exist, the macro stops at the point it trys to kill the missing window. THis could be by desing but if it is, how do I code the macro to contine on to start the new ppplication if the first window odesn't exist.

In the Find a Window macro dialog box, remove the check mark from the option "Stop macro if target is not found".
